Why allied health hiring keeps getting harder

Demand for healthcare professionals continues to grow. The U.S. is projected to add about 1.9 million healthcare job openings every year through 2034, driven by industry growth and the need to replace retiring workers. That means competition for experienced allied health professionals will only become more intense.

Unlike many healthcare roles, most allied health positions also require state licensure or profession-specific certifications before a clinician can begin working. As a result, the available talent pool is often much smaller than it appears.
